> On 02/12/2015 11:30, Paolo Bonzini wrote:
> > diff --git a/include/exec/cpu-all.h b/include/exec/cpu-all.h
> > index f9998b9..87a4145 100644
> > --- a/include/exec/cpu-all.h
> > +++ b/include/exec/cpu-all.h
> > @@ -174,11 +174,10 @@ extern unsigned long reserved_va;
> > #define TARGET_PAGE_MASK ~(TARGET_PAGE_SIZE - 1)
> > #define TARGET_PAGE_ALIGN(addr) (((addr) + TARGET_PAGE_SIZE - 1) &
> > TARGET_PAGE_MASK)
> >
> > -/* ??? These should be the larger of uintptr_t and target_ulong. */
> > extern uintptr_t qemu_real_host_page_size;
> > -extern uintptr_t qemu_real_host_page_mask;
> > +extern intptr_t qemu_real_host_page_mask;
> > extern uintptr_t qemu_host_page_size;
> > -extern uintptr_t qemu_host_page_mask;
> > +extern intptr_t qemu_host_page_mask;
> >
> > #define HOST_PAGE_ALIGN(addr) (((addr) + qemu_host_page_size - 1) &
> > qemu_host_page_mask)
> > #define REAL_HOST_PAGE_ALIGN(addr) (((addr) + qemu_real_host_page_size -
> > 1) & \
> > diff --git a/translate-all.c b/translate-all.c
> > index a940bd2..7a15109 100644
> > --- a/translate-all.c
> > +++ b/translate-all.c
> > @@ -118,7 +118,7 @@ typedef struct PageDesc {
> > #define V_L1_SHIFT (L1_MAP_ADDR_SPACE_BITS - TARGET_PAGE_BITS - V_L1_BITS)
> >
> > uintptr_t qemu_host_page_size;
> > -uintptr_t qemu_host_page_mask;
> > +intptr_t qemu_host_page_mask;
> >
> > /* The bottom level has pointers to PageDesc */
> > static void *l1_map[V_L1_SIZE];
> > @@ -326,14 +326,14 @@ void page_size_init(void)
> > /* NOTE: we can always suppose that qemu_host_page_size >=
> > TARGET_PAGE_SIZE */
> > qemu_real_host_page_size = getpagesize();
> > - qemu_real_host_page_mask = ~(qemu_real_host_page_size - 1);
> > + qemu_real_host_page_mask = -(intptr_t)qemu_real_host_page_size;
> > if (qemu_host_page_size == 0) {
> > qemu_host_page_size = qemu_real_host_page_size;
> > }
> > if (qemu_host_page_size < TARGET_PAGE_SIZE) {
> > qemu_host_page_size = TARGET_PAGE_SIZE;
> > }
> > - qemu_host_page_mask = ~(qemu_host_page_size - 1);
> > + qemu_host_page_mask = -(intptr_t)qemu_host_page_size;
> > }
> >
> > static void page_init(void)
> > diff --git a/translate-common.c b/translate-common.c
> > index 619feb4..171222d 100644
> > --- a/translate-common.c
> > +++ b/translate-common.c
> > @@ -21,7 +21,7 @@
> > #include "qom/cpu.h"
> >
> > uintptr_t qemu_real_host_page_size;
> > -uintptr_t qemu_real_host_page_mask;
> > +intptr_t qemu_real_host_page_mask;
> >
> > #ifndef CONFIG_USER_ONLY
> > /* mask must never be zero, except for A20 change call */
> >
> >
>
> Ok, I tested this by adding
>
> + assert(HOST_PAGE_ALIGN(0x123456700ll) == 0x123457000ll);
> + assert(REAL_HOST_PAGE_ALIGN(0x123456700ll) == 0x123457000ll);
>
> and doing a 32-bit x86_64-linux-user build. Since Dave's patch does not
> compile for user-mode emulation (ram_addr_t is a softmmu concept), I'm
> queuing my patch for 2.5.
Hmm yes OK; my alternate was just making ram_addr_t being always defined.
I'm not sure we have any other type that's more suitable than ram_addr_t
but I guess the intptr_t will work for the mask.
